To amend the Omnibus Public Land Management Act of 2009 to make the Reclamation Water Settlements Fund permanent.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led,
SEC. 2. Reclamation water settlements fund.
Section 10501 of the Omnibus Public Land Management Act of 2009 (43 U.S.C. 407) is amended—
(1) in subsection (b)(1), by inserting “and for fiscal year 2031 and each fiscal year thereafter” after “For each of fiscal years 2020 through 2029”;
